There may be some database method for dealing with this, but if not, you
might try URLEncoding the French text and then undoing it when you bring it
out of the field later on. URLEncoding will replace international
characters and punctuation with standard character codes.

I really appreciate your input and assembling the SQL as a variable worked
for me. However, one minor detail I neglected (cause I didnt think it would
be an issue) . The long string a user submits will likely be in French,
which means a lot of single and double quotes and strange characters. I am
now able to submit this field under normal circumstance, but my code is
choking on these characters... I bet you guys can nail this one pretty
quick... I must need a function when I set that large string as a
variable... Your help is very much appreciated. code is below:
<%@ taglib uri="jruntags" prefix="jrun" %>
<% String news_ID= request.getParameter("news_ID"); %>
<% String newsletter_ID= request.getParameter("newsletter_ID"); %>
<% String heading= request.getParameter("heading"); %>
<% String entry= request.getParameter("entry"); %>
<% String enteredby=request.getParameter("enteredby"); %>
<% String newslettermonth= request.getParameter("newslettermonth"); %>
<% String newsletteryear= request.getParameter("newsletteryear");
String sqlQuery = "INSERT INTO news (newsletter_ID, heading, entry,
enteredby) VALUES ("
+newsletter_ID + ", '"
+heading+ "', '"
+entry+"', '"
+enteredby+"')"; %>
<%--INSERT NEWSITEM--%>
<jrun:sql datasrc="afdallas" id="allnews">
<%=sqlQuery%>
</jrun:sql>
